Play War of Castle: Rush royale and Drag and Drop Walkthrough
War of Castle: Rush Royale and Drag and drop is an addictive drag and drop game. Drag and drop the brave little man to fight the onslaught of bats! Your goal is to destroy all enemies by gently moving your character across the screen. Collect bonuses, upgrade weapons, and evolve to tackle increasingly difficult levels. Demonstrate dexterity and strategic thinking to become a true master of the bat hunt!
BTS Minecraft Coloring
Hiker Escape
Draw Spinning
Anime Girls Fashion - Makeup & Dress up
Ben 10 Matching The Memory
Air Force
Poke the Buddy
Fashion Short Hair Dress up
Angry Ninjas
Fun Memory Training
Evoke
Fantasy Fairy Tale Princess
Street Escape 2
Castle Destruction Blocks
Fashion Princess: Dress Up Day!
Rick and Morty Card Match
Angry Birds Halloween
Only
Frog Block
Turbo Racing 3D HTML5
Brain Teasers : Colors Game
Panda Run Game
Battleship War Multiplayer
Kids Pet Hotel
Forest House Girl Escape
Cave Club Dolls Jigsaw Puzzle Collection
Cinderella Party Dressup
The Archer
ZombieCraft 2
Dominoes Battle: Domino Online